The IZh-18 (ИЖ-18) is a single-shot, break-action shotgun. History IZh-18 was designed in 1962-1963 as a successor to the IZhK, since 1964 began its serial production.Отечественные ружья // журнал «Охота и охотничье хозяйство», № 11, 1964. стр.21Наши ружья. ИЖ-18 // журнал «Охота и охотничье хозяйство», № 1, 1987. стр.48-49 In November 1964, the price of one standard IZh-18 was 28 rubles. Since January 1979 began the production of IZh-18E-20M and IZh-18-410M variants In May 1981, the price of one standard IZh-18 was 22 rubles and 50 kopecks, the price of one standard IZh-18E was 37 rubles and 50 kopecks. Since March 2018 ZAO "Техкрим" began to produce a detachable 520mm barrel ТК600 for IZh-18 shotguns. With TK600 barrel this gun can shoot .366 TKM cartridges.Михаил Дегтярев. Перспективное вложение. Izhevsk Mechanical Plant
Izhevsk Mechanical Plant (russian: Ижевский Механический Завод, ''Izhevsky Mekhanicheskiy Zavod'') or IZHMEKH (ИЖМЕХ) was a major firearms manufacturer founded in Izhevsk in 1942 for manufacturing small arms. History It was one of the primary factories producing Mosin–Nagant and SVT-40 rifles during World War II for standard issue to Soviet troops. After the end of World War II, it continued producing firearms, both for military (Makarov pistols) and hunting applications, and later high-tech weapons and civilian machinery. In 1948, the plant began production of Margolin pistols. In 1956, the plant began production of IZh-56 combination guns. Since 1960, Izhmekh supplied hunting shotguns for export under the trademark "Baikal". The first model that began to sell for export was IZh-54 In 1973 plant began production of PSM pistol, in 1978 - IZh-35 pistols. Remington Spartan 100
The Remington Spartan 100 is a single-shot, break-action shotgun. It is a variant of a classical Russian IZh-18 shotgun manufactured by Izhevsk Mechanical Plant for export under trademark "Baikal", in Izhevsk, Russia. It is marketed and distributed by Remington.SPR100 Firearm Model History on Remington.com
The Spartan 100 accepts -inch or 3-inch s. It utilizes a cross bolt and a selectable ejector or extractor.

IZhK
The IZhK (''ИЖК'') is a Soviet single-shot, break-action shotgun. History IZhK was designed in 1955 and it was based on previous ZK single-shot model. It was made by Izhevsk Mechanical Plant. Since 1961, a new varnish with improved characteristics has been used to protect the wooden parts of the gun. As a result, since January 1961, the price of one standard IZhK was 19 roubles. In 1962-1963 new IZh-17 and IZh-18 models were designed as a successors to the IZhK,Оружейные новинки ижевцев // журнал «Охота и охотничье хозяйство», № 8, 1964. стр.33-35 since 1964 began their serial production. However, the last IZhK shotgun was made in 1965. Design The IZhK is simple smoothbore break-action shotgun.
